Results for Contrarian, Wanger, and Oshaughnessy
Saturday, April 25th, 2009To avoid generating rankings prematurely, I wait to generate scores until a screen or experts picks have 5 sets of picks which have reached the 10-week maturity mark. The Contrarian, Wanger GARP, and OShaughnessy Growth investment strategies have now reached this mark, and are listed in the most recent stock strategy scores post. All three […]
